FRISCO, Texas — Northwestern State's Emily Senatore, Kennedy Rist and HCU's Alexia Murillo have won this week's Jersey Mike's Southland Conference Women’s Soccer Player of the Week awards, the conference office announced Tuesday. They are the first winners of the 2025 season.
Offensive Player of the Week: Emily Senatore – Jr. – M – Oxford, Conn. (Oxford High School)
Emily started the season with a bang, scoring two goals in the season-opening victory over Texas in one of the biggest upsets in Southland Conference history. She first scored in the fifth minute and then gave the Demons the lead in the 72nd minute, clinching the 3-2 win.
Defensive Player of the Week: Alexia Murillo, HCU – Sr. – M – San Antonio, Texas (Brandeis High School)
Murillo was a constant on the field for the Huskies on the opening weekend, logging 180 minutes and scoring a goal against Rice. Played a huge role as part of a defense that limited Tarleton State to just two shots on goal over the final 76 minutes after HCU fell behind 2-0 early, giving the Huskies a chance to come back and earn a big 3-2 road win.
Goalkeeper of the Week: Kennedy Rist, Northwestern State – Jr. – GK – Palm Harbor, Fla. (East Lake High School)
Rist had 19 saves in two games this past weekend, including 13 in the Demons upset victory at nationally ranked Texas. She followed that up with six more against SMU. She had a strong save percentage of .826 and leads the SLC in both saves (19) and saves per game (9.3) through one week of competition. Rist also delivered a key outlet pass that set up a game-tying goal against the Longhorns, giving her an assist for her first career point.
